4.0 out of 5 stars Concise hard rockin' package, April 11, 2008
This review is from: Hits & Pieces (Audio CD)
18 tracks of Australia hard rock comprise this album by a band who seemed poised to achieve so much more, and on an international scale too.

This disc showcases the fact that this rawk rock band had a very muscular bent most of the time and overall from this compilation we learn a number of things about this domestically successful band. One is that they were blessed with mulitple songwriters all capable of penning a dar fine pub rocker. Another is that they could address both youthful exuberance and some degree of introspection on some of the mellower numbers.

A further strong aspect of this collection is the pacing. Outright rockers such as C'mon and major domestic hit Better are interspersed with more plaintive tunes such as Needle and Shivers and numbers that fall somewhere between the two such as Helping Hand..

Weak points are few and far between espcially if your Australian because so many of these songs will already be familiar to you and will get that grin of recognition from you. And if your a newcomer you'll find The Screaming Jets style of rawk rock fairly easy to digest. This is mostly due to the strength of the riffs and rollickin' chorus construction.

An easy and breezy four stars for this fine compilation from an Australian band that seemed destined for bigger things than their eventual fate of the endless East Coast trek (Australian East coast that is).

2.0 out of 5 stars Hits & Misses, November 26, 2000
This review is from: Hits & Pieces (Audio CD)
I bought this cd primarily to round out my Oz pub rock collection - I'd enjoyed a number of Screaming Jets singles over the years but never enough to buy an album. I took a punt on this greatest hits collection and was disappointed.

There are at most half a dozen good rock songs, such as Better, Helping Hand, Shivers, October Grey and Eve of Destruction, and maybe one or two others. The rest are bland and indistinguishable from each other.

If they'd left out the "pieces" and cut it down to the best 10 or so songs I'd probably have given it 3.5 stars and recommended it to anyone who has enjoyed any of the above mentioned songs. However with the gems scattered through the dross, this cd rarely makes it into my stereo, so it is for hard-core fans only - who probably already have all the songs anyway.

If you're looking for some awesome Oz pub rock, check out Hunters & Collectors' Under One Roof, a live recording from their final tour. Brilliant.
